What Type of Product is PeriGuard Ointment?

PeriGuard Ointment is classified as a combination product designated as a Human Over-the-Counter (OTC) Skin Protectant intended for Topical and External use. This classification is intended to ensure the product's fundamental safety and efficacy for its non-prescription purpose. The ointment form is specifically positioned to offer a substantial protective layer for patients requiring defense against friction and incontinence-associated skin irritation.

Composition and Pharmacological Class

The formulation's primary active components are Zinc Oxide and Petrolatum, which define its Dermatological Protectant pharmacological class. The Petrolatum Base provides the occlusive properties, which are essential for creating a water-repellent film that protects the skin. Zinc Oxide provides astringent, soothing, and protective effects. This dual-component composition, featuring both the petroleum-derived occlusive agent and the mineral-based astringent, provides a robust physical barrier that differentiates it from single-entity emollients.

General Purpose and Barrier Action

The general purpose of the ointment is to establish a strong physical barrier on the skin, mitigating the effects of continuous exposure to irritants and friction. The combination works through moisture seclusion and an astringent effect. For instance, in settings involving reduced mobility, the Petrolatum effectively seals out wetness and prevents dehydration, while the Zinc Oxide contributes to the soothing of the irritated tissue, thereby protecting the area and supporting the skin's natural integrity.

What side effects are possible with Periguard?

Possible Side Effects and Safety Information

Regulatory safety documents define the safety profile of Periguard Ointment, a topical skin protectant containing Zinc Oxide and Petrolatum, by focusing on local application-site effects and mandatory use restrictions. The adverse reactions are classified primarily under Skin and Subcutaneous Tissue Disorders and Immune System Disorders.

Documented Adverse Reactions

Adverse reactions associated with the use of this topical preparation are mainly local and are classified as Incidence not known in official regulatory documents. These effects may involve signs of local irritation or sensitivity, including:

  • Itching (Pruritus)
  • Hives (Urticaria)
  • Skin rash at the application site
  • Worsening of the underlying skin condition

Serious Adverse Reactions

Government labeling requires documentation of the potential for a severe allergic reaction or hypersensitivity as a serious adverse reaction. Signs indicative of this type of reaction may include difficulty breathing, wheezing, or swelling of the face, lips, tongue, or throat. These reactions necessitate immediate discontinuation of use.

Regulatory Safety Restrictions and Duration Limits

The product is designated for external use only by regulatory mandate. Official safety labeling imposes mandatory constraints, strictly prohibiting its application on deep or puncture wounds, animal bites, or serious burns. Additionally, contact with the eyes must be avoided.

Consistent with official regulatory standards, a duration-related safety limit is specified: use must be discontinued if the skin condition worsens or if the symptoms being treated persist for more than seven days, as this indicates the need for further evaluation.

Overdose and Emergency Response

PeriGuard Ointment is a topical skin protectant, and the overdose scenario documented in regulatory sources relates to accidental ingestion. Regulatory documents classify the acute toxicity of the product's active ingredients as generally low, and a long-term recovery is very likely following typical exposure.

Overdose warnings are explicitly directed toward the pediatric population, mandating that the product be kept out of the reach of children.

Documented Overdose Manifestations

Manifestations following accidental swallowing are generally confined to the gastrointestinal system. Officially documented signs include nausea, vomiting, stomach pain, and diarrhea. Less common, acute symptoms cited in regulatory-supported literature may involve fever, chills, or irritation of the mouth and throat.

Hospital monitoring, if required, may include measuring vital signs and performing blood and urine tests to guide care.

Immediate Action Required

Official labeling mandates strict emergency action following any known or suspected ingestion. If swallowed, immediately contact a Poison Control Center or seek urgent medical help.

Medical personnel are required to assess the situation and provide symptomatic and supportive treatment, as no specific antidote is known for this product. Urgent contact with the local emergency number is required if the individual collapses or exhibits a decreased level of consciousness.

What should I know about interactions with other medicines?

Interactions with other medicines and products

The official interaction profile for this product, a topical skin protectant containing Zinc Oxide and Petrolatum, is primarily restricted by its negligible systemic absorption. This non-systemic nature means the ointment does not participate in the body's internal drug metabolism or transport pathways.

Systemic Drug Interactions

No clinically significant systemic drug-drug interactions are documented in official regulatory labeling. Due to its minimal absorption, the product is not subject to clearance by metabolic enzymes, such as the Cytochrome P450 (CYP) system, and does not affect the concentrations of orally administered systemic medicines. Consequently, there are no documented formal contraindications for co-administration with systemic medications.

Topical and Local Restrictions

Caution is noted regarding co-administration with other topical products. Applying another medicine or product to the same area of skin simultaneously may alter the local therapeutic effect of either preparation or compromise the occlusive barrier provided by the ointment. Additionally, regulatory documents note a physico-chemical incompatibility between Zinc Oxide and certain compounds, specifically Benzylpenicillin.

Procedural Constraints

A mandatory timing restriction exists related to medical imaging. The content of Zinc Oxide can be radio-opaque and may mask X-ray pictures of the treated area. Use of the ointment should be separated from or considered in the context of diagnostic imaging procedures.

Dosage and Administration Information

Periguard Ointment is strictly designated for topical and external use only, administered according to a high-level, condition-based regimen. As a skin protectant, its usage is governed by the principle of maintaining a continuous physical barrier on the skin's surface.

Administration Protocol

The preparation phase is mandatory for proper use. The area of skin requiring protection must first be cleansed of irritants and residue and subsequently allowed to dry completely before the ointment is applied. This prerequisite step ensures optimal adherence and effectiveness of the protective barrier.

Dosing and Frequency

The official instruction for dosing is to apply the ointment liberally to fully cover the entire area. The amount used is determined solely by the surface area requiring coverage, as the product is not systemically absorbed. The frequency of application is defined as as often as necessary to ensure the protective film remains intact. For instances involving continuous exposure to wetness, the product should be reapplied with each change of the wet or soiled dressing.

These administration principles apply uniformly across all age groups, as no age-specific dosage adjustments are stated in the official labeling. The procedural steps—cleaning, drying, and liberal application—define the standardized protocol for the proper and intended use of this medicine.

Q: Where can I find summaries of the clinical trials for Periguard?

Summaries of regulatory data and official product labeling are compiled and available on government databases. This information resides on sites such as DailyMed, which compiles the Structured Product Labeling (SPL) files for the FDA.


Q: Does Periguard contain any common allergens?

Official product labeling lists both the active ingredients (Zinc Oxide, Petrolatum) and the inactive ingredients used in the formulation. The official labeling states that the product is contraindicated for individuals with a known allergy or hypersensitivity to any of the ingredients.


Q: Can Periguard affect the results of common lab tests?

The official warning indicates that the Zinc Oxide component in the ointment is radio-opaque. This means it may mask X-ray pictures of the treated area, and this should be considered before undergoing any diagnostic imaging procedures.


Q: How long is a typical course of treatment with Periguard?

Official directions state that the product should be applied as often as necessary to maintain the protective barrier. However, safety warnings indicate that use should be stopped if the skin condition worsens or if symptoms persist for more than seven days.

Q: Is Periguard a newly developed drug, or has it been around for a while?

The active ingredients, Zinc Oxide and Petrolatum, are long-established compounds regulated under a specific FDA Monograph that was finalized in 2003. According to regulatory marketing data, this specific product formulation has been available since at least 2011/2014.

How should Periguard be stored and disposed of?

How to Store and Dispose of Periguard

Periguard Ointment must be stored under Controlled Room Temperature conditions, maintained between 20 C to 25 C (68 F to 77 F).


Storage Requirements

  • Temperature and Protection: The product must be protected from excessive heat and moisture and must not be frozen. It is required to keep the ointment in a closed container.
  • Child Safety: Periguard must be stored securely out of the reach of children.

Disposal

Unused or expired product must be disposed of in accordance with local, state, or federal regulations.

For disposal into household trash, official guidance advises mixing the product with an undesirable substance, such as used coffee grounds, and placing the mixture in a sealed container before discarding.
